What is Silicone Laminated AFO?

A silicone sleeve containing within it a thermoplastic shell. The silicone sleeve extends from approximately mid-calf to the ball area of the foot. It opens along the posterior (back) section of the leg and has an opening at the heel area. The posterior opening is secured with velcro closures.

What does it do?

It applies a lifting force to the foot to allow for clearance when the foot swings through and its design allows for a very flexible, thin  and cosmetic AFO. The inclusion of  thermoplastic within the Orthosis provides more structural control than is available when using a purely silicone device. It is not suitable for all foot drop types.
